Embedded Lift Proof Pages for Creators

Fitness creators and micro-influencers may pay for more polished presentation of their best lifts, especially if video can appear inline with strong mobile performance. This extends the basic profile concept into a creator-branding tool rather than a pure tracker.

Why this matters

If your training content is part of your personal brand, a generic bio link or social profile does not show your lifting credibility very well. Followers, sponsors, or new gym contacts may want to see actual best lifts, but the proof is buried among many unrelated posts. A dedicated page can solve that, yet plain outbound links feel less polished than embedded proof. The commercial opportunity is not just tracking numbers; it is helping creator-style athletes present performance evidence in a format that looks professional, loads quickly on phones, and gives them analytics on who is viewing their strongest lifts.

Why This Might Fail

Self-rebuttal — the most important trust signal

  1. 1Creators may already be satisfied with general-purpose bio-link tools and not value a niche variant enough to switch.
  2. 2Inline video experiences may break or degrade due to third-party platform restrictions.
  3. 3The addressable market could remain too narrow unless the product expands beyond lifting.
